#6977f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6977fe is composed of 41.2% red, 46.7%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.7% cyan, 53.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 234.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 70.4%. #6977fe color hex could be obtained by blending #d2eeff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6977f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6977fe has RGB values of R:105, G:119,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 6911998.

Shades and Tints of #6977f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000106 is the darkest color, while #f1f3ff is the lightest one.
